Buckley, James P. – Papers

Description

Opportunity and Anaconda, Montana, native James P. Buckley served in World War II and invented the “Buckley Bomb” to drop propaganda materials behind enemy lines. Papers consist of a scrapbook about Buckley, his bomb, and his later family life.
